Columbia Financial (CLBK) Net Interest Margin At 2.42% Tests Bullish Growth Narratives

Columbia Financial (CLBK) opened 2026 with Q1 revenue of US$66.2 million and basic EPS of US$0.13, anchored by net income of US$13.1 million. This puts fresh numbers behind the company’s recent return to profitability. The business has seen revenue move from US$55.9 million and EPS of US$0.09 in Q1 2025 to US$66.2 million and EPS of US$0.13 in Q1 2026, with trailing twelve month EPS at US$0.55 as the earnings base rebuilds. CoastalSouth Bancshares (COSO) Net Interest Margin Holds At 3.59% Reinforcing Bullish Profitability Narratives

CoastalSouth Bancshares (COSO) opened 2026 with Q1 total revenue of US$21.3 million and basic EPS of US$0.53, supported by net income of US$6.3 million. Over recent quarters, total revenue has moved from US$18.0 million in Q1 2025 to US$21.3 million in Q1 2026, while quarterly EPS has ranged from US$0.49 to US$0.60 across that period. Ocular Therapeutix Data Strengthens AXPAXLI Durability Case And FDA Ambitions

Ocular Therapeutix (NasdaqGM:OCUL) released new 52-week post hoc Phase 3 data for AXPAXLI in wet age-related macular degeneration. The SOL-1 trial data indicated better durability, strong sustained disease control, and safety outcomes compared to aflibercept. The company presented the findings at a major ophthalmology conference and plans to seek FDA approval with a single pivotal Phase 3 trial. Autoliv Broadens Airbag Reach As Asian Growth And Valuation Gap Stand Out

Autoliv (NYSE:ALV) is expanding beyond traditional car airbags into motorcycle and wearable airbag safety products. The company has introduced its first motorcycle airbag and wearable airbag solutions, targeting riders and other vulnerable road users. Autoliv has recently outperformed in Asian markets such as China, India, and South Korea alongside this product expansion.
